Details and limits
How to check
Start, then roll the wheel slowly and quickly only inside the test zone. Check up/down, reversals, large gaps, and zero gaps.
Limits
Trackpads, high-resolution wheels, and OS acceleration change event patterns. This is not a hardware grade.
If something feels wrong
If direction feels wrong, check OS or browser scroll direction first.
FAQ
Many reversals mean a broken wheel?
Hand tremor, acceleration, or a trackpad can look like reversals. Treat them as observations.
ΔY values jump around.
They are browser deltas only — not physical distance or polling rate.
